Family friendly hiking trails around Schnackenburg are situated along the Elbe River, where the Aland flows into it, offering a blend of riverine environments and protected natural areas. The region is characterized by its location within the Lower Saxony Elbe Valley Biosphere Reserve, featuring riparian forests, wet meadows, and sandbanks. Hikers can expect varied terrain including forests and heathlands, with generally low elevation changes.

👉🏻 historical location of an observation tower (BT FüSt - 4x4 usually 6m high and served as a command post) The signal system of the border section converged here (including for the border signal fence, the gates, water crossings), the border reporting network, and the company's communication and information system. 👉🏻 Today, there is again a wooden observation tower here to observe nature and get a view over a bird-rich floodplain.

Actually, there are two lakes. Beautifully situated in the landscape, on the Green Belt, the former border strip between West Germany and East Germany. The beautiful river Aland also flows past here. Here you also have good opportunities to observe and photograph birds and wild animals. On my bike tours, I always enjoy cycling past here and like to make a stopover here.

Are there any specific attractions or points of interest along the family trails?

Yes, several trails offer interesting sights. You can explore beautiful lakes like Gartower Lake or Rambower Lake in the Rambower Moor, or discover historical sites such as Eldenburg Manor and Quitzow Tower. The region's rich history and natural beauty provide plenty to see.

Where can we find scenic views or observation points?

For fantastic panoramic views, consider visiting the Schwedenschanze observation tower, which offers sweeping vistas over the southern section of the Lower Saxony Elbe Valley Biosphere Reserve and the winding Elbe River. You can also enjoy idyllic views of the Elbe from vantage points like Waldeck Castle and the Schnackenburg harbor tower.

Are there opportunities to see wildlife during our hike?

The Lower Saxony Elbe Valley Biosphere Reserve, which many trails traverse, is rich in biodiversity. Hikers often have the chance to spot beavers, otters, wild boars, and a variety of bird species, including storks, herons, and migratory birds, especially near the Elbe River and its floodplains.
